LT21 CXK is a 2021 Porsche Cayenne in White with a 2,995cc hybrid electric (clean) engine. This vehicle has been through 4 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2021 Porsche Cayenne models, the average MOT pass rate is 93.5% with a typical mileage of 29,678 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Porsche Cayenne f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 5,217 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LT21 CXK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Porsche Cayenne typ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 5 years old, this Porsche Cayenne is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
